The Fighting Irish name came about as a result of Notre Dame students ( many being Catholic which to the KKK was not much better than the ethnic groups they despised) taking on a bunch of KKK marchers in 1920s in Indiana. The KKK was trying to recruit state legislators and politicians in the Midwest in this time period with the eventual goal of Senators, Governors and even President. A great book on the topic is:
